Some cool videos from my demo page:
- DVFB1:
Two Puma robots learning to fold a flexible piece of foam.
- DVFB2:
"Pickup"-style 3 phase robot control:
3DOF point reach, 6 DOF alignment and 6 DOF final move in.
- Puzzle1 and
Puzzle2
Robot putting different shaped kids puzzle pieces into corresponding
slots under visual space planning and control.
- Bulb:
Puma arm with UTAH/MIT hand picking up, transporting
and screwing in a lightbulb using visual space planning
and control.
- Prescision:
Puma arm with UTAH/MIT hand picking up a small marble using
adaptive visual feedback control.

My background:
I grew up in a small city Karlstad in the province
Värmland , located on
the north shore of the big lake Vänern in the middle of
Sweden.
In Karlstad I studied at
Älvkullegymnasiet
Then I went to Chalmers
which is located in the
city of Gothenburg on
the Swedish (Atlantic) west coast.
At Chalmers I studied Physics, Mathematics and Computer Science, with
special interest in computational physics, numerical analysis/optimization,
and machine vision.
Now I'm in the USA doing work in vision and robotics . I started this work
at University of Rochester and now I'm at the Center for Vision and
Control at Yale University.
